Surface Transfer Systems: Stability and Strength Factors

The dependable operation of mining establishments heavily is predicated on the performance of conveyor belts. Guaranteeing a blend of safety and secure performance is indispensable due to the extensive volumes of components they shift. Imminent hazards, including belt breakage, slippage, and off-tracking, require thorough inspection schedules and regular maintenance. Furthermore, the difficult mining background – distinguished by dust, moisture, and forces – heightens wear and has the potential to cause untimely failure, demanding the use of hardy belt materials, relevant idler bearer, and sophisticated monitoring methods to decrease risk and amplify longevity of the instruments.

Improving the Duration of Your Conveyor Assembly: Supports, Loops, and Extras

To ensure a uninterrupted and efficient operation, planned maintenance is vital for your conveyor framework. Focusing on critical ingredients like wheels and tapes can considerably lengthen their productive span. Defective rollers often lead to uneven band abrasion, creating a compounding issue. Inspecting bands for holes, misalignment, and abrasion is essential. Consider a comprehensive maintenance plan that includes regular inspections, carrier interchange whenever necessary, and chain servicing.
